Value-Setting Your Home for Success

Selling your home is Affordable homes in Miami and Fort Lauderdale a significant decision, and one of the most crucial elements is setting the right price. Pricing too high can lead to weeks or even months on the market, while Failing to maximize your returns means leaving money on the table. Striking that sweet spot requires careful consideration of current market trends, comparable sales in your locality, and the unique features of your property.

  • Reach out to a local real estate agent: Their expertise and knowledge of recent transactions can provide invaluable insights.
  • Research comparable homes that have recently sold in your area. Pay attention to factors like size, location, and condition.
  • Consider any recent updates you've made to your home. These can increase its value.

Through a strategic pricing strategy, you can attract interested parties, generate excitement, and ultimately sell your home for its fullest value.
